The use of robotically assisted surgery for treating urachal anomalies

Summary
Robot-assisted surgery effectively manages urachal anomalies, including cancer. This minimally invasive approach using the da Vinci robot proved safe and feasible for radical excision of the urachal tract.

Background:
- Urachal anomalies are rare congenital malformations.
- Management often involves surgical excision.
- Robot-assisted surgery offers potential benefits in minimally invasive procedures.
Purpose of the Study:
- To evaluate the safety and efficacy of robot-assisted surgery for urachal anomalies.
- To describe the surgical techniques employed for urachal remnant excision and adenocarcinoma treatment.
Main Methods:
- Retrospective review of five patients (2005-2006) with urachal anomalies.
- Utilized two robot-assisted approaches: partial cystectomy and radical cystectomy.
- Histological assessment of excised specimens.
Main Results:
- All five robotic procedures were technically successful.
- Three patients with urachal adenocarcinoma showed no recurrence at 8-month median follow-up.
- Partial cystectomy patients demonstrated well-healed bladder mucosa without recurrence.
Conclusions:
- Robot-assisted radical excision of the urachal tract is safe and effective.
- The da Vinci robot facilitates feasible surgical management of urachal anomalies.
- Minimally invasive robotic surgery is a viable option for urachal pathologies.
